TensorFlow is a full-featured open-source framework for creating machine learning applications. It is a symbolic math toolbox that uses dataflow and differentiable coding to perform a number of operations aimed towards deep neural network inference and training. It lets developers to create machine learning software by utilising a variety of tools, frameworks, and community resources.
